The Sisters Country, including the charming town of Sisters, Oregon, quaint Camp Sherman, Suttle Lake, Black Butte and Hoodoo, all where central Oregon starts, is a destination like no other.  The Sisters Country is an expanse of majestic and inspiring natural beauty reaching from the town of Sisters, Oregon, to the panoramic Pacific Crest Trail. Explore Central Oregon outdoor adventure and cultural experiences including the world renowned Sisters Rodeo, Sisters Outdoor Quilt Show, or the Sisters Folk Festival.

 

If you're looking for outdoor adventure, hiking, fishing, camping, golfing, rafting, mountain biking, skiing, horseback riding, snowmobiling, or just plain getting away to relax, you can do it all in Sisters Country. On the edge of town, the Deschutes National Forest offers a 1.6 million-acre playground laced with miles and miles of trails, rivers, lakes, wilderness areas, scenic drives and vistas, clean air, and star filled nights. Choose from rustic cabins, simple campgrounds, or rub shoulders with world class resorts, all within minutes of downtown Sisters. Come make yourself at home.

In 1888 the post office was relocated to the John J. Smith Store, about three miles south of Camp Polk. It was proposed the post office be named "Three Sisters." Postal authorities shortened the name to 'Sisters.'
